Using the Mag Top of Form Option
Step Procedure
1 Enter a negative value to move the start of the magnetic data more toward
the leading edge of the card or the card output side of the Printer.
OR
Enter a positive value to move the start of the magnetic data toward the
trailing edge of the card or the card input side of the Printer.
• Magnetic Data Direction: The arrows on these buttons indicate the
direction the magnetic data will move on the card's Magnetic Stripe.
• Maximum Adjustment Range: The maximum adjustment range is ±
99. As a rule, 20 equals about .030"/. 8mm.) (Note: Keep this in mind
when adjusting this option to avoid over-adjusting.)
Caution: If the negative value is set too high, the Printer may
start encoding before the card's Magnetic Stripe reaches the encoding
head.
